Use of radioisotopes in studying factors responsible for alfalfa resistance to bacterial wiltxng

Description
Studies are summarized dealing with possible causes of vascular dysfunction and resistance of alfalfa to bacterial wilting caused by Corynebacterium insidiosum (McCull.) H.L. Jens from the physiological and biochemical points of view. Using 32P, 35S, 54Mn, 45Ca, 65Zn, and 86Rb the uptake, distribution, translocation, and metabolism of these elements in plants with a different resistance against diseases were investigated. The possible use is discussed of 86Rb as a tracer of potassium. The results suggest that the resistance of alfalfa to bacterial wilting is probably determined by several factors. (author)
